The Charles River Esplanade stretches along three miles of the beautiful Charles River and surrounding attractions. This spot is perfect for relaxating outdoors and enjoying a picnic, fishing, taking a gondola ride, or just sprawling out on a blanket and watching the river roll by. There are also several scheduled events here like fitness classes and festivals.
Wine connoisseurs, get your tickets to Chef Daniel Bruce's Boston Wine Festival, one of the nation's longest-running wine events. This isn't your typical, two-day festival; the festival spans three and a half months and hosts a few events each week. The 23-year-old event features wine tastings, paired with signature dishes created by Chef Bruce. Throughout the history of the Boston Wine Festival, the menu has never been repeated.
Strap on your skates and tear up the ice at the Boston Common Frog Pond. If you're not so good on your feet, sign up for skating lessons; if you know what you're doing with those skates, show off on the ice. Also, the pond features College Night on Tuesdays. Get a little cold on the ice? Stop at the Frog Pond Cafe for a cup of coffee to keep you warm.
